n-gram and decision tree based language identification for written words

J. Hakkinen1, Jilei Tian2
1Nokia Mobile Phones Limited, Tampere, Finland
2Nokia Research Center, Tampere, Finland

Tóm tắt

As the demand for multilingual speech recognizers increases, the development of systems which combine automatic language identification, language-specific pronunciation modeling and language-independent acoustic models becomes increasingly important. When the recognition grammar is dynamic and obtained directly from written text, the language associated with each grammar item has to be identified using that text. Many methods proposed in the literature require fairly large amounts of text, which may not always be available. This paper describes a text-based language identification system developed for the identification of the language of short words, e.g., proper names. Two different approaches are compared. The n-gram method commonly used in the literature is first reviewed and further enhanced. We also propose a simple method for language identification that is based on decision trees. The methods are first evaluated in a text-based language identification task. Both methods are also tested as preprocessors for a multilingual speech recognition task, where the language of each text item has to be determined, in order to choose the correct text-to-pronunciation mapping. The experimental results show that the proposed methods perform very well, and merit further development.

Từ khóa

#Decision trees #Natural languages #Speech recognition #Mobile handsets #Automatic speech recognition #Testing #Vocabulary #Usability #Signal processing #Embedded computing

Tài liệu tham khảo

mitchell, 1997, Machine Learning 10.1109/HICSS.1999.772689 10.1109/ICASSP.2001.940753 quinlan, 1993, C4.5. Programs for Machine Learning 10.1109/ICASSP.1998.675369 häkkinen, 2000, Development of Robust Speaker Independent Command Word Recognition for Car Hands-Free Applications, Workshop on Robust Methods for Speech Recognition in Adverse Conditions, 139 schmitt, 1991, Trigram-based Method of Language Identification suontausta, 2000, Decision Tree Based Text-To-Phoneme Mapping For Speech Recognition, International Conference on Spoken Language Processing-2000, 831 grefenstette, 1995, Comparing Two Language Identification Schemes, 3rd International Conference on Statistical Analysis of Textual Data, 1